Monkeyhead has just finished a series of four spots to promote Red Bull's BC One Competition that focuses on the four elements of Hip Hop. The Los Angeles effects facility used a variety of tools--from Adobe After Effects and Maxon Cinema 4D to the Red digital camera system and BOXX Technologies render farms to complete the spots over the course of just five weeks.

In this clip, host Damian Allen details how to Quantize audio with the Flex technology in Logic Pro 9, which enables you to perform the same process with digital audio. He shows how to enable the flex mode to use the Quantize feature in Logic Pro 9.

The reach of the Internet has opened the door for companies to be in direct touch with millions of individuals who want to obtain information and discuss your company, products, services and your capabilities. They have thousands of online outlets to research virtually anything - and anyone - who exists on the planet. The challenge for companies is how to participate with these people, win them over or neutralize their issues.
